The core of a laser welding machine lies in its high-energy density laser beam. This beam of light, like a surgical knife in the hand of a surgeon, is both precise and efficient, capable of heating materials to their melting point in a very short time, achieving fast and precise welding. Compared to traditional welding methods, laser welding does not require direct contact with the workpiece, reducing physical pressure and heat affected zones, thereby ensuring that the microstructure of the welding area is not damaged and improving the overall performance of the product. In addition, it can effectively avoid common problems such as material deformation and cracks, ensuring the stability and reliability of welding quality.
When it comes to features, the advantages of laser welding machines are countless. Firstly, its extremely high flexibility. Whether it is welding of the same or different materials, laser welding can easily handle it, even including some difficult to weld materials such as aluminum alloys, titanium alloys, etc., and can demonstrate extraordinary welding effects. Secondly, with a high degree of automation and modern control systems, fully automated production processes can be achieved, greatly saving labor costs and improving production efficiency. Furthermore, laser welding has high precision and the width of the weld seam can be controlled within a very small range, which is particularly important for the processing of precision components. Finally, the environmental characteristics cannot be ignored. The laser welding process produces almost no harmful gases or waste, which is in line with the concept of green manufacturing.
